Overview of Citi:
Citi is a world-leading global bank. We have approximately 200 million customer accounts and a presence in more than 100 countries and jurisdictions worldwide. We provide consumers, corporations, governments, and institutions with a broad range of financial products and services, including consumer banking and credit, corporate and investment banking, securities brokerage, transaction services, and wealth management. We enable clients to achieve their strategic financial objectives by providing them with cutting-edge ideas, best-in-class products and solutions, and unparalleled access to capital and liquidity.
Overview of the organization:
The COO Enterprise Solution Engineering capability is responsible for the development of best-in-class technology platforms for Operations, including development of an integrated portfolio of Operations tools, end-to-end solution design for large scale transformation initiatives, design governance, and adoption of Generative AI solutions for driving operational efficiencies.
Job Description
We are hiring a Technology Director to lead the design and development of a critical Cash & Intraday Liquidity Management platform. This is a senior level position that will provide leadership for the development of a platform that sits at the intersection of engineering ambition and real-world financial impact - for a wide range of internal and external consumers. This is a rare opportunity for a hands-on engineering leader to own a multi-year technical roadmap, build and scale a world-class global engineering organization, and deliver AI-first, cloud-native systems that operate with the highest standards of availability across multiple geographies and regulatory environments. If you are energized by hard product development, solution architecture and engineering problems, thrive at the intersection of solution vision, technical depth & organizational scale, and want your work to matter at a global level - this role is built for you. The technology lead will be responsible for leading variety of architectural and engineering activities including the analysis of functional requirements, solutions design, evaluation of different options and presenting comparative analysis along with recommendation to senior stakeholders. Individual will apply in-depth domain knowledge of financial services to grasp all facets of the multiple dimensional business problems and develop solution options. The individual will lead a team of technical business analysts, data analysts, and solution architects to deliver solution design for real-world business problems. Individual must have a passion for architectural simplification, and a demonstrable commitment for building sustainable, future-ready platforms
Individual needs to be results-oriented, innovative and motivated to drive opportunities in efficiency gains, enhanced controls and extendible scalability. This is articulated and demonstrated through various types of strong deliver artifacts. This high performing team designs enterprise-wide solutions for critical business needs leveraging solutions, business, technical, and data architecture. Key stakeholders include operations teams, product teams and application development teams from different LoBs & functions within the organization. These engagements are global.
